The Advanced Certificate in Insect Molecular Ecology Bioinformatics Pipelines equips learners with specialized skills in analyzing genomic data for insect-related research. Participants gain hands-on experience in bioinformatics tools and techniques, focusing on molecular ecology applications.
Key learning outcomes include mastering bioinformatics workflows, interpreting insect genomic datasets, and applying computational methods to ecological studies. The program emphasizes practical skills in data analysis, pipeline development, and molecular marker identification.
The course typically spans 6-12 months, offering flexible learning options to accommodate working professionals. It combines online modules, interactive workshops, and project-based assessments to ensure comprehensive understanding.

Bioinformatics Analyst: Specializes in analyzing genomic data from insect populations to identify molecular markers and ecological trends. High demand in UK research institutions and biotech firms.
Molecular Ecologist: Focuses on studying insect biodiversity and evolutionary patterns using bioinformatics tools. Key role in conservation and environmental agencies.
Genomic Data Scientist: Develops algorithms and pipelines for processing large-scale insect genomic datasets. Critical for advancing precision agriculture and pest control.
Research Scientist (Insect Genomics): Conducts cutting-edge research on insect genomes to understand molecular mechanisms. Highly sought after in academia and industry.
